Good accommodation for one-night stay, especially for business trip and event attending purposes. Location is excellent within the limit of city center of BSD City, South Tangerang, only walking distance from Foresta Business Lofts, about 5-10 minutes drive from Aeon Mall and ICE BSD, depending on the traffic condition. Receptionist is at the 3rd floor, Alfamart (a minimart) is at the lobby. Pagi Sore Restaurant (Padang cuisine) is right next to the hotel. Suitable for solo traveller, two persons the most. The room sizes for Standard Twin Room and Standard King Room are small, plus private bathroom and toilet (ensuite). Room is clean, bed and pillows are comfy. Amenities like toiletries are minimum; only liquid soap doubles as shampoo in a dispenser at the shower (hot and cold), two bath towels, one bathroom mat, and one roll of tissue. You have to buy additional IDR25,000 for a pack of toothbrush and toothpaste, so better bring your own. There’s a mini safe in the room, two nightstands on both sides of the bed, flat-screen TV, AC, free wifi, no wardrobe and only a couple of hangers for clothes, no mineral water and only a water bottle with two small glasses. The room can be a bit noisy at night because the hotel is located on the side of a main road.

Honestly, this hotel is great for a 1-star hotel, and it has convenience store and a cafe. The room is nice and clean. As you go in the room, you will be greeted with a very huge floor-length mirror. My standard room has 2 bedside table with storage each, and a folding table by the window. The size of the room is pretty decent too, with some empty space to pray (also has qiblat direction). The TV have some good channels 👍 The bed has good bounce, the pillow is comfortable, but a bit too firm for me. AC works really well, and the lights are all working. Hotel provided guests with a glass bottle that you can fill with water at water dispensers outside in the corridor, and 2 glass to drink from. A pretty great and sustainable idea! In the bathroom, you can have hot showers and they provided the soap/shampoo and towels. Bathroom is cool and clean too, with big sink and mirror, and exhausting fan. Hotel's original price doesn't include toothbrush/toothpaste, but you can buy it from the front desk for Rp. 20k, or you can just buy it from the convenience store. You can choose to have breakfast or not, but the breakfast is not buffet. I chose not to, and just buy instant noodle from the convenience store on 1st floor (they close at 11 p.m.). Work station can be found in 3rd floor near the lobby. Doesn't have AC so it's gonna be hot, I suggest you work in your room with the folding table if you're uncomfortable. I book this room with less than Rp. 300k/day. I find it cheaper to book from other booking's websites instead of hotel's own website, but the price may vary during holidays or weekends. Check-in is also a good experience with friendly staffs. I went to Comifuro 16 event. It's a very pleasant stay, although it's kinda far from any restaurant if you want to order online. I used Grab for travel to ICE BSD, the price is about Rp. 16-18k without promo.
